High Voltage Compatible! C0G Characteristic Capacitor for Resonant Circuits that Supports Higher Output and Miniaturization of Automotive OBCs
On Board Chargers (OBCs) installed in electric vehicles are becoming increasingly powerful, with an output power of 22 kW. Even at higher power output levels, it is not acceptable to increase the size of the OBC itself, so compact design is required. Capacitors for the resonant circuit function are required to have high withstand voltage and low loss products that can withstand higher power densities than conventional products.
In order to meet this demand, TDK has released a new autograde C0G MLCC series with a rated voltage of 1250 V.

Product Development Utilizing TDK's Proprietary Pattern Coil Technology
TDK's proprietary pattern coil technology allows for precise and flexible adjustments to the thickness of copper traces based upon application requirements. This capability enables highly customizable coil designs that are not achievable with conventional copper coil technologies such as those created by etching.
The end-product lineup includes: wireless power transfer coils, RFID/NFC antennas for both communication and power, and EMI mesh screens. By applying pattern coil technology, it can be developed for a variety of end uses.
